Resolving Root inode is not a directory. Clear Linux Error

In Linux operating system, you can check the integrity of file system and hard drive. This command resolves majority of issues with hard drive and file system, avoiding need of Linux Data Recovery. This command-line utility runs in five phases. In first phase, it checks data blocks and their size, in second phase, it checks for path names. In the following phases, connectivity, references counts, and the cylinder groups are examined respectively. If the fsck fails in second phase, situations can be very drastic.

The fsck may fail in the second phase due to iNode issues. In a practical scenario, you may come across the below error message while checking integrity and consistency of your system through fsck utility:

-Root inode is not a directory. Clear?-

After this error message, you can not access your Linux hard drive and encounter serious data loss situations. In order to gain access of your valuable data in such circumstances, you need to find out the cause of this problem and perform Data recovery linux by sorting it out.

Grounds of the issue:

This problem occurs after corruption to the root iNode. The corruption might be caused by improper system shutdown, virus infection, system crash, and more.

In Linux file system, iNode is a data structure that holds all the critical information of files and directories, except their names and contents. It is a unique number, assigned to every file/directory. Every file/directory has an individual iNode. The file/directory is accessed through iNode only.

In the particular situation, the root iNode of Linux system is damaged. It is generally the second iNode. Root iNode is first iNode to file system and it represents starting point or root of file system.

If you select ‘Yes’ in above error message, it will remove parent entry of every iNode from root directory. In third phase of the fsck utility, root iNode is tried to recover, but you encounter further error if the process fails:

-Cannot Allocate Root Inode-

How to Fix Unable to resolve UUID Error in Linux

Modern distributions of Linux operating systems use UUID (Universally Unique Identifier) to uniquely identify hard drive or other data storage devices, in place of the conventional block names like /dev/sdb and /dev/hda1. It is due to the fact that UUID is never modified, even if the hard drive is switched. It is stable as compared to traditional methods, and prevents system failure and need of Linux Data Recovery solutions.

UUID is a 128-bit string that is used for making the Linux hard disk management simple. If you look at /etc/fstab file in your Linux computer, you find the entry in the following format, in place of the familiar hard drive designation:

UUID=62fa5eac-3df4-448d-a576-916dd5b432f2

In comparison to the traditional hard drive identification techniques, UUID is quite easy and reliable. For instance, in the traditional Linux systems, when you try to insert a new hard drive in a system that already has two hard drives, the drive is inserted between existing drives. At this point, ‘mount’ command attempts to mount the newly inserted drives as home.

In such situation, you need to log on as a single user for resolving the problem. However, when you log on, it gives you some error message and in the worst case scenario, you may encounter kernel panic. You can fix this issue using UUID.

UUID creates a unique entry for each hard disk volume in the Linux file system tree. Using UUID offers easy management of your Linux hard disks and creates less complication while adding or removing the disk.

Although, UUID is quite useful and it provides various advanced features, but it also has some faults. Sometimes, you may encounter the below error message when you attempt to access a UUID based Linux hard drive:

-Fsck 1.40.8 (13-Mar-200 fsck.ext3: Unable to resolve ‘UUID=d8533154-cef1-4cce-a823-9f3f74aab65b’-

Linux Data Recovery Using ‘myrescue’ Utility

In Linux operating system, myrescue is an utility to retrieve still-readable information from damaged hard drive. This Linux Data Recovery tool is similar to the dd_rescue, however it attempts to quickly get out of corrupted area to handle undamaged part first. After extracting data from the undamaged area, the utility then returns to the damaged area and tries to fix it.

The myrescue utility attempts to copy your hard drive block-wise to the file and creates a block bitmap (table) remarking whether the block is successfully copied, not handled yet or it has errors. The block bitmap or table can be employed in the successive runs for concentrating on unresolved blocks.

This Data Recovery Linux utility effectively handles the read errors, through its special skip way. General the hard drive surface blemishes cover more than simply one data block and uninterrupted reading data from the defected areas may damage the hard drive surface, the hard drive mechanisms, and read/write heads.

When it occurs, the possibilities of retrieving the remaining and undamaged data decreased dramatically. Therefore in the skip mode of myrescue, it attempts to escape the damaged area quickly by exponentially incrementing the step size. It marks the skipped blocks as un-handled in block bitmap table and they may be retrieved at later stage.

Ultimately, the utility has an advanced option to multiply attempt for reading data from a data block, before believing it is damaged.

However, you should bear in mind that this utility is not a replacement for third-party data recovery utilities. When you have a second option, do not even try to use myrescue, as the tool may cause more damage to your hard drive.

The myrescue utility is available only for the situation that you’re completely desperate and cannot afford any professional Linux Recovery utility. If your data is highly significant for your business, it is worth to go for professional recovery applications.
